What the white card covers and why it matters on site
The white card confirms you have completed the nationwide unit of competency for building induction training, presently CPCWHS1001, Prepare to work securely in the building sector. You might still listen to the older code CPCCWHS1001, typically made use of interchangeably in course ads and on older certifications. The proficiency focuses on understanding typical hazards, risk control procedures, PPE, case reporting, and standard rights and responsibilities under work health and safety law.
On an online Gold Coast site, that expertise converts into day one safety and security. You will be anticipated to recognize breakable roof covering panels before entering a gap zone, tag out damaged leads, acknowledge silica dust threats throughout chasing, and speak up if an exclusion zone is breached by a distribution vehicle driver. Supervisors see the distinction between a person that can name the pecking order of controls, and someone that automatically applies it when choosing between engineering and administrative controls. That is the objective of the white card training course on the Gold Coast, not to make you a safety and security policeman, but to help you prevent predictable events in the initial weeks on site.
Face to encounter or online in Queensland
The expression white card online Gold Coast shows up in searches due to the fact that many training firms supply e-learning elsewhere in Australia. Queensland has tighter settings. Work Health And Wellness Queensland calls for white card training to meet particular delivery and identification confirmation standards, and in most cases that implies in person. There are limited scenarios where on-line distribution may be allowed by authorized providers using real-time supervision and robust ID checks, but if you survive on the Shore and plan to function right here, the most basic and most reliable course is a classroom session supplied by a Queensland signed up training organisation.
This is not red tape for its very own purpose. Trainers wish to see you demonstrate standard safety tasks, not simply tick boxes. On the day, you will practise fitting PPE, pointing out threats from case photos, finishing an incident kind, and describing your choice of danger control. That can not be faked by clicking via slides. If you hold a white card from interstate that was issued under legitimate policies, it is identified nationally. However buying an inexpensive on-line card from a supplier that does not meet Queensland demands can leave you disallowed from eviction the first early morning. When in doubt, ask the principal service provider white card training course what they accept, and check the company's range on training.gov.au.
Typical expenses on the Gold Coast
Most white card training Gold Coast sessions cost between 90 and 160 Australian bucks. The spread depends on location, course size, class size, and whether the charge includes the physical budget card or the Declaration of Accomplishment. Well-run venues with free car park and smaller groups have a tendency to sit in the 120 to 150 variety. If you see a price much listed below that, look closely at the fine print. Some budget offers press the actual card concern to a later day for an additional charge, or cost for rescheduling. Clear Gold Coast white card courses provide the total cost clearly, consist of both the Declaration of Achievement and the card, and define what happens if you require to change dates.

Employers in some cases cover the charge when hiring teams of new starters for a project. Union members might have accessibility to subsidised training. If you are a college student in a VET path, your college might set up a white card training course Gold Coast wide through a companion RTO at a bargained price. Those plans differ, so validate what is consisted of before you transform up.

What you need to enrol and attend
You do not need building and construction experience. You do require to please the entrance checks. Queensland RTOs run through similar needs because they are bound by the training bundle and regulator expectations. You will be asked for a Distinct Trainee Identifier, appropriate picture ID, and proof you can read and write basic English. Instructors are not attempting to trip any person up, but they need to be confident you can review a danger indicator, translate a Safe Work Technique Declaration, and write a simple report.
Under 18s can normally enlist with parental or guardian permission. The exact minimum age differs by supplier plan. I regularly see 15 and 16 year olds in pre-apprenticeship teams, along with job changers in their thirties and forties. If English is not your first language, ask about assistance. Some RTOs supply language assistance, slower-paced sessions, or the alternative to bring a thesaurus. You will likewise be informed to wear enclosed shoes. Instructors commonly provide high-vis vests and sample PPE for demonstrations, however you are far better off bringing your own if you already possess it. Practising with equipment you will in fact wear on site helps.

How assessment works and what counts as evidence
Competency suggests you can do the jobs, not simply explain them. Fitness instructors gather proof in three methods. Initially, they analyze understanding via brief written reactions or spoken examining. You might be asked to list actions for reporting an incident, or describe exactly how you would certainly control threats throughout a hands-on handling job. Second, they view you do straightforward demonstrations, such as suitable a construction hat correctly, selecting ideal gloves for a task, or pointing out hazards in a picture set. Third, they examine your capacity to review and full basic safety and security documentation. If you have problem with reading, allow the instructor know early. Many can assess verbally within the rules.
A well developed white card Gold Coast training session offers you multiple possibilities to reveal understanding. I have seen anxious trainees ice up on a written test, only to beam when talking with an actual scenario from their last task in warehousing. Trainers appreciate getting you qualified without reducing corners. If you are not yet showing the requirement, they will certainly describe what needs improvement and, reasonably, provide you time to fix it. If you need to come back for a second attempt, trustworthy service providers arrange it without difficulty, often for a tiny fee to cover costs.
Getting your Declaration and card
After you are significant skilled, you receive a Declaration of Achievement for CPCWHS1001. Lots of Gold Coast white card training service providers issue the Declaration the exact same day by e-mail, which works if you are due on site in the morning. The physical white card is typically issued by the RTO in behalf of the regulatory authority, after that printed and sent by mail. Distribution times vary. Expect anywhere from a couple of service days to two weeks. Many major contractors on the Shore accept the Statement of Accomplishment as temporary evidence while you await the card, but check website guidelines in advance. If a project office insists on the plastic card prior to induction, you do not want to find out that at 6.30 am at the turnstile.
If you shed your card, get in touch with the RTO that provided it. They can usually set up a substitute for a charge after confirming your identity. If the RTO has closed, you can utilize your Declaration of Attainment and your USI records as evidence up until you sort a reissue. Maintain digital duplicates of your documents in a cloud folder you can access on your phone. Supervisors are practical. If you can produce a valid Statement and your ID on the spot, the majority of will certainly allow you proceed to website induction while you arrange a replacement card.
Validity, refresher course expectations, and interstate recognition
A white card does not have a set expiry day. That stated, if you have not accomplished building work for a long stretch, two years is a typical benchmark made use of in advice, you may be asked to re-train prior to you return. It makes sense. Safety methods move on, materials and methods adjustment, and you do not wish to relearn fundamentals by hand around cranes and edge protection. Companies on the Gold Coast usually fold refreshers into their onboarding for returning employees. If you are unclear whether your card condition serves, call the site safety and security officer a day ahead.
Interstate recognition is built right into the system because the system is nationwide. If you earned your card in New South Wales, Victoria, or elsewhere, it needs to be accepted on a Queensland website supplied it was issued in accordance with that state's policies at the time. Problems develop when individuals complete a cheap online course that did not meet the releasing state's verification requirements, then existing it in Queensland. Once again, choose an acknowledged supplier and keep your documentation straight. Common risks and how to prevent them
The most regular problems I have seen are simple and very easy to avoid. Individuals show up without a USI and spend their first break on the phone attempting to produce one. Create or recoup your USI the day before. Others arrive without acceptable ID, for instance an image of a licence that is also fuzzy to review, and can not be signed up. Bring the initial. One more pitfall is assuming that a course marketed as white card training Gold Coast online will be accepted by a Queensland principal professional. If you remain in Queensland, err on the side of one-on-one with a neighborhood RTO.
Occasionally, candidates ignore the literacy part. The course does not call for essays, however you need to read basic safety and security details and create short responses. If that worries you, call the supplier. A five minute conversation can solve it. They may seat you at the front, enable additional time, or assess some parts vocally where permitted. Ultimately, do not schedule a 12 pm induction on a distant website the same day as your training course. Most sessions complete promptly, but delays happen. Offer yourself room.
